EU Gas prices steady – ING
|European natural Gas prices steadied after last week’s decline, as supply concerns eased with improved Norwegian flows. However, firm price support may still be needed to secure LNG ahead of next winter, Société Générale's FX analysts note.
Storage builds, flows recover
"European natural Gas prices were little changed yesterday, after coming under downward pressure over the last week. EU Gas storage continues to tick higher, with it now more than 65% full, down from the 5-year average of 74%. A recovery in Norwegian Gas flows to Europe following an unplanned outage last week has eased supply concerns."
"We still believe that European Gas prices will need to remain well supported through the year to ensure enough LNG is brought into the region ahead of the 2025/26 winter."
